Transaction 7684b11089252ead518f481f1ccc7701027d38fbbb89ffba4e54fc49aca77821
1 Input
1 Output
-
7684b11089252ead518f481f1ccc7701027d38fbbb89ffba4e54fc49aca77821:0
- value
- 98515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01cc7fce64e6e4c17945939438faff2dd5cf8abe OP_EQUAL
- address
- 31rXabJ3j7L7f3TQ42H2V1ukDzqPxm9yzM